Visual Inspection

A regular visual inspection is essential to identify any damage or wear and tear on the propeller. This involves checking the propeller for any signs of cracks, dings, or corrosion. Before conducting a visual inspection, ensure that the propeller is clean and dry. Look for any irregularities or damage to the blades, hub, and shaft. Check for any signs of wear on the propeller’s surface, such as scratches or corrosion.

Use a flashlight to illuminate any hard-to-reach areas.

  • Check the propeller for any signs of damage or wear and tear.
  • Inspect the propeller’s surface for any signs of corrosion or scratches.
  • Check the propeller’s blades for any signs of damage or wear and tear.
  • Inspect the propeller’s hub and shaft for any signs of damage or wear and tear.

Cleaning and Lubrication

Proper cleaning and lubrication are essential for maintaining the propeller’s performance and longevity. Use a soft-bristled brush to remove any dirt, debris, or corrosion from the propeller’s surface. Avoid using any harsh chemicals or abrasive cleaners, as they can damage the propeller’s surface. Apply a specialized lubricant to the propeller’s shaft and hub to prevent corrosion and wear and tear.

Regular cleaning and lubrication can help extend the lifespan of the propeller and improve the engine’s performance.

How often should I inspect and maintain my propeller?

It’s recommended to inspect your propeller regularly, especially after each use, and perform maintenance tasks such as cleaning and lubricating as needed.
